The Castle on Silver Lake

The Castle, now an eleven room Bed and Breakfast, was built over a long period of time during the 50's, 60's and 70's by Sam Jones of Norfolk, Va. Mr. Jones contributed greatly to the economy of Ocracoke during these times and is considered by many to be a local legend. He is buried on the Island with his favorite horse Ikey D. Although most of the original furnishings have long been auctioned off, the Castle is furnished with antiques. The Castle sat vacant for nineteen years before two businessmen and long time friends brought it. Much thought was put into what was to be done with the Castle because it is an historical landmark and a monument to all the local craftsmen who built it. Finally, the Castle was split into two halves, and one partner took the front half and the other took the back and the nearby Whittler's club. A rental duplex was built beside the Castle along with the Castle Villas, master suites and studio bedrooms for rent.
